The great thing about this town is the citizens who have a real passion for England and the English that has been developed over the 56 years and have been handed down through the generation of links with Ashford in Kent that is now one of the longest and most successful twin town relationships with Germany.

Charming little getaway. Has lots of outlet stores and many restaurants. Free parking at walking distance from city center. Some restaurants do not accept cards, only cash. Also a good starting point for hikes in the surround hills.

Lovely hotel on the edge of the town centre, an easy walk away. A quiet location by the small river Erft which caused so much destruction in 2021. Steinsmühle was sadly affected as well but has been tastefully restored. Breakfast was included offering lots of choices.
